Q33.In the circuit below, A and B represent two inputs and C represents the output. The circuit represents (1) NOR gate (2) AND gate (3) NAND gate (4) OR gate

What This Question Tests

This question tests the ability to analyze a transistor circuit and identify the logic gate it represents. If either A or B is high, the corresponding transistor conducts, pulling the output C low. If both A and B are low, both transistors are off, and C is pulled high, which is the truth table for a NOR gate.
